GB 65Mn Steel Coil, AISI 1066, ASTM 1566

65Mn steel coil is a spring steel with high strength, certain toughness and plasticity, good hardness and good wear resistance. And 65Mn steel is very good for making knives, and can also be used as various flat and round springs, cushion springs, spring springs, etc. in small sizes. GB 65Mn Steel Coil Chemical Composition

GradeC (%)Fe (%)Mn(%)P(%)S (%)
GB 65Mn/ AISI 1066/ ASTM 15660.60 - 0.71 % 98.05 - 98.55 % 0.85 - 1.15 % ≤0.040 %≤0.050 %

1566 Steel Coil Mechanical Properties

Mechanical Properties
Poissons Ratio (Typical For Steel)0.27-0.30
Elastic Modulus (GPa)190-210
Tensile Strength (Mpa)1158
Yield Strength (Mpa)1034
Elongation (%)15
Reduction in Area (%)53
Hardness (HB)335

65Mn Steel Coil Application

1. Used for springs with small size, such as pressure-adjusting and speed-regulating springs, force-measuring springs, square coil springs or drawn steel wires as springs on small machinery.

2. It can produce spring rings, valve springs, clutch reeds, brake springs and cold-drawn steel wire coil springs.

3. The main material for making diamond circular saw blades

4. High wear-resistant parts, such as grinding machine spindles, spring chucks, precision machine tool screws, cutters, collars on spiral roller bearings, railway rails, etc.

65Mn Steel Round Bar Coil Sheet Plate Heat Treatment

Heat Treatment Specifications
Quenching 830°C±20°C, oil cooling; Tempering 540°C±50°C (±30°C for special needs).

65Mn Spring Steel Annealed
In the traditional annealing process, first slowly heat to 730 ºC and allow enough time to allow the steel to be fully heated, keep it warm for 13 hours, and then cool the furnace to 650 ºC, then leave the furnace and air cool. Then 65Mn tool steel will get MAX 250 HB (Brinell hardness).

New annealing process: annealing temperature (860±10)°C, heat preservation for 45-60min, furnace cooling to (750±10)°C, heat preservation for 3-3.5h, after furnace cooling to 650-660°C, heat preservation The pit is slowly cooling. The metallographic structure meets the requirements: the pearlite structure is 2.5-6 grades, preferably around 4 grades, and the process improves the efficiency by 80%-100%.

Quenching of GB 65Mn Steel
65Mn steel should be started by heating uniformly to 830-860°C (1526-1580°F) until fully heated. After approximately 30 minutes per 25 mm of scribed section, the steel should be quenched in oil immediately.

Tempering of 65Mn Steel
65Mn steel is tempered at 540°C by soaking at the selected temperature for a minimum of 1 hour per 25mm of total thickness. Hardness values at different temperatures after tempering.
